数据库求总成绩写什么

worktile 其他 8

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要求总成绩,需要对数据库中的数据进行求和操作。具体的写法取决于数据库的类型和查询语言,以下是几种常见数据库的写法示例:

    1. SQL Server:
    SELECT SUM(成绩) AS 总成绩 FROM 表名;
    
    1. MySQL:
    SELECT SUM(成绩) AS 总成绩 FROM 表名;
    
    1. Oracle:
    SELECT SUM(成绩) AS 总成绩 FROM 表名;
    
    1. PostgreSQL:
    SELECT SUM(成绩) AS 总成绩 FROM 表名;
    
    1. SQLite:
    SELECT SUM(成绩) AS 总成绩 FROM 表名;
    

    以上写法中,表名需要替换为实际的表名,成绩需要替换为实际的成绩字段名。执行以上查询语句后,会返回一个包含总成绩的结果集。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    要求计算数据库中学生的总成绩,可以使用SQL语句进行查询和计算。假设数据库中有两张表,一张是学生表(students),另一张是成绩表(scores)。学生表包含学生的基本信息,如学号、姓名等;成绩表包含学生的各科成绩信息,如学号、科目、成绩等。

    首先,我们需要连接两张表,以获取学生的成绩信息。使用INNER JOIN关键字来连接两张表,连接条件是学生表中的学号与成绩表中的学号相等。

    然后,我们使用GROUP BY语句按学号进行分组,以计算每个学生的总成绩。在GROUP BY语句之后,可以使用聚合函数SUM来计算成绩的总和。

    最后,我们可以使用ORDER BY语句按总成绩的降序排列学生,以便查看总成绩最高的学生。

    下面是一段示例的SQL语句,用于计算学生的总成绩并按总成绩降序排列:

    SELECT students.学号, students.姓名, SUM(scores.成绩) AS 总成绩
    FROM students
    INNER JOIN scores ON students.学号 = scores.学号
    GROUP BY students.学号, students.姓名
    ORDER BY 总成绩 DESC;
    

    以上SQL语句中,students表示学生表的表名,scores表示成绩表的表名,学号、姓名、成绩分别表示学生表和成绩表中的字段名。

    执行以上SQL语句后,将返回学生的学号、姓名和总成绩,并按总成绩降序排列。可以根据需要,将结果导出或进一步处理。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要计算数据库中的总成绩,可以使用SQL语句来实现。下面是一个基本的方法和操作流程,你可以根据自己的具体情况进行适当调整。

    1. 创建数据库表
      首先,需要在数据库中创建一个表来存储学生的成绩信息。表的结构可以包括学生ID、科目、成绩等字段。
    CREATE TABLE scores (
      id INT PRIMARY KEY,
      student_id INT,
      subject VARCHAR(255),
      score FLOAT
    );
    
    1. 插入数据
      接下来,向表中插入一些示例数据,以便进行计算。
    INSERT INTO scores (id, student_id, subject, score)
    VALUES 
      (1, 1, 'Math', 90),
      (2, 1, 'English', 85),
      (3, 2, 'Math', 95),
      (4, 2, 'English', 92),
      (5, 3, 'Math', 88),
      (6, 3, 'English', 90);
    
    1. 计算总成绩
      使用SQL的聚合函数SUM来计算总成绩。通过对score字段进行求和即可得到结果。
    SELECT student_id, SUM(score) AS total_score
    FROM scores
    GROUP BY student_id;
    

    以上SQL语句将按照学生ID进行分组,并计算每个学生的总成绩。结果将返回每个学生的ID和总成绩。

    如果你想要同时显示学生的姓名,可以将学生信息存储在另一个表中,并使用JOIN操作将两个表关联起来。

    1. 显示结果
      最后,根据需要将计算结果显示出来。可以使用数据库客户端工具或编程语言来执行SQL语句,并将结果以表格或其他形式输出。

    以上是一个基本的方法和操作流程,你可以根据实际情况进行适当调整和扩展。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部